Fremont, CA: The industrial automation sector is experiencing a significant transformation. This evolution is being fueled by advancements in various technologies, including artificial intelligence (AI), collaborative robots, and the integration of the Internet of Things (IoT). Businesses that effectively harness these emerging technologies and embrace automation will gain a competitive edge, especially in the face of labor shortages, increased demand, and limited budgets that continue to pose challenges for many industries.

Efficient Manufacturing with Digital Technology Adoption
Advanced technologies like generative AI, digital twins, and 4D vision enhance efficiencies across various manufacturing sectors. Regardless of their scale, enterprises are expected to increase their investments in these technologies as they become more widely available.
Usage of Digital Twins is Set to Increase:
A digital twin is an electronic duplicate of a tangible system, item, or operation. Although they have been around for a while, their usage will expand. Digital twins offer benefits such as:
Accelerated time to market by swiftly iterating products and optimizing designs.
Enhanced product quality by detecting flaws in manufacturing procedures.
Improved employee training.
Heightened sustainability by minimizing waste from discarded materials.
Predictive maintenance.
Generative AI Will Transform Businesses:
Artificial intelligence (AI) offers a holistic comprehension of ongoing operations and can anticipate machinery failures in the manufacturing sector by analyzing data. The combined utilization of generative AI (AI) and automation presents revolutionary potential for enterprises. AI will continue to be a valuable asset in product development, while automation will act as the driving force behind the realization of these products.
4d Vision Will Revolutionize How Robots Move:
Incorporating vision technology into robots has provided significant benefits to businesses, improving their effectiveness. Vision is a crucial sensory component for robots, allowing them to carry out tasks while prioritizing and guaranteeing safety in their working environment.
Moving beyond traditional vision technology, the introduction of 4D vision has transformed automation processes by integrating artificial intelligence (AI) and a more advanced level of human-like characteristics. The enhanced features of 4D technology enable quicker image processing, resulting in a substantial increase in the speed at which robots perform automated tasks.
